Graham Hornsby

Graham’s working career started at the age of 16 back in 1989 when he joined the armed forces. Having completed basic training at the Junior Leaders Battalion in Shorncliffe, Graham was sent to 1st Battalion the Royal Regiment of Fusiliers and served as a Fusilier for the next 24 years. During this time, Graham was deployed to a number of war torn countries and employed in a number of different roles.

Through the latter stages of his forces career, Graham started to get more involved with driver training, training on LGV vehicles, Dangerous Goods (ADR) and Material Handling Equipment. In July 2013, Graham left the forces with a number of highly sort after qualifications and started working within The Transport & Logistics sector delivering Accredited Forklift / Plant & First Aid qualifications to employees for companies around the south.

Graham is a Lantra instructor, delivering First Aid at Work, Emergency First Aid at Work plus Forestry and Forklift training courses around the UK for H&W Training.
